Abstract

In the last decade, Combined PET/CT has been introduced into the field of oncologic imaging representing a unique imaging modality that scans the whole body integrating functional information from a PET scan with anatomical information from a CT scan. Combined PET/CT is considered a major breakthrough in oncologic imaging with valuable applications in head and neck malignancies. It is very efficient with least possible pitfalls and false results compared to either of its components alone and to side by side reading of separately acquired PET and CT. It can be a standard modality for lymphoma providing a new vision to management and treatment plan. The future of Combined PET/CT seems bright with new applications are awaited with great interest.
